About Entenloch Gorge
The Entenloch Gorge, known in German as Entenlochklamm, is a striking 2.5-kilometer-long water gap carved by the Leukental river. Situated on the border between Bavaria, Germany, and Tyrol, Austria, the gorge is a dramatic passage through a transverse mountain range characterized by steep rock walls. The river, known as the Großache as it approaches the gorge and then the Tiroler Achen as it flows into Tyrol, has sculpted this landscape over millennia.
Geology and Formation
The gorge's formation is attributed to the Großache river's persistent erosion through resistant geological layers. It cuts through steeply placed bars of Rhaetian limestone and Jurassic rock, which form the southern boundary of the Oberwössener depression. This durable bedrock meant that the river could only create a gorge-like passage since the last ice age. Above the gorge on the Austrian side, the pilgrimage church Maria Klobenstein is nestled in a depression formed by weathered layers, with its name derived from a large rock deposited by a landslide.
Historical Context and Development
The Entenloch Gorge has been a site of both natural hazards and human activity. Since the 16th century, the area has experienced several extreme floods of the Großache, prompting significant flood control measures. A notable disaster in 1899 led to a large-scale flood control project, with the regulation of the Großache from 1906 to 1922 involving blasting to widen the gorge from its original narrow stretch of about 3.4 meters to 12 meters. This widening aimed to mitigate flooding upstream in the Kössen valley basin by preventing debris from becoming wedged.
Historically, the gorge was also associated with a smugglers' path, accessed via a hanging bridge. This route was used by residents of the border area to transport goods like cigarettes, alcohol, and coffee, thereby evading customs duties.
Modern Tourism and Accessibility
In recent years, efforts have been made to enhance the touristic appeal of the Entenloch Gorge in a sustainable manner. As part of an Interreg project, a 35-meter-long hanging bridge was constructed in 2021 at a height of 28 meters, accompanied by a new viewing platform, resting spots, and parking facilities. This development allows visitors to experience the gorge's natural beauty more readily. A loop trail incorporating both hanging bridges and the viewing platform takes approximately 50 minutes to complete and is moderately hilly. The longer 'Smugglers' Path' from Kössen to Schleching spans 7.5 km and is estimated to take about two hours to walk.
